Output cecdc74d70f27927ad48e41d6c05ccc5fc652aa97d6c8b0841d71dc60b51db24:15

value
68585
script pubkey
OP_0 OP_PUSHBYTES_20 3d31e9b7910be8443403edbaada543640a79092b
address
bc1q85c7ndu3p05ygdqraka2mf2rvs98jzft6sz833
transaction
cecdc74d70f27927ad48e41d6c05ccc5fc652aa97d6c8b0841d71dc60b51db24